在当今的信息化时代,MySQL作为一款开源的、高性能的关系型数据库管理系统,已经被广泛应用于各种场景。对于MySQL服务器类型的配置,是确保数据库稳定运行、高效服务的重要环节。本文将从MySQL服务器类型的概述、配置要点、衍升问题及相关问答等方面进行深入探讨。
一、MySQL服务器类型概述
MySQL服务器类型主要分为以下几种:
1. MySQL Community Server:即开源版MySQL服务器,免费提供给用户使用,适合个人学习和小型项目。
2. MySQL Enterprise Server:即企业版MySQL服务器,为用户提供更多高级功能和专业支持,适合大型企业、高性能要求的项目。
3. MySQL Cluster:即MySQL集群服务器,采用分布式存储和计算技术,适用于高可用性、高性能的场景。
4. MySQL ClusterCGE:即MySQL集群云服务器,是MySQL Cluster在云环境下的实现,适用于云计算、大数据等场景。
二、MySQL服务器配置要点
1. 硬件配置
(1)CPU:建议使用多核处理器,以便提高并发处理能力。
(2)内存:根据实际业务需求,配置足够的内存,以确保数据库的稳定运行。
(3)硬盘:建议使用SSD硬盘,以提高I/O性能。
2. 软件配置
(1)操作系统:建议使用Linux操作系统,如CentOS、Ubuntu等。
(2)MySQL版本:根据项目需求选择合适的MySQL版本,如MySQL 5.7、8.0等。
(3)配置文件:合理配置MySQL配置文件(my.cnf),优化数据库性能。
3. 安全配置
(1)设置root密码:确保root用户密码复杂,防止未授权访问。
(2)限制远程访问:关闭不必要的外网访问,仅允许授权的IP访问。
(3)使用SSL连接:确保数据传输的安全性。
三、衍升问题及相关问答
1. 问题:MySQL Community Server和企业版MySQL Enterprise Server有什么区别?
回答:MySQL Community Server是开源版本,免费提供给用户使用,适用于个人学习和小型项目。而MySQL Enterprise Server是企业版,提供更多高级功能和专业支持,如高可用性、性能监控、备份恢复等,适用于大型企业、高性能要求的项目。
2. 问题:如何选择合适的MySQL服务器类型?
回答:选择合适的MySQL服务器类型需考虑以下因素:
(1)项目规模:小型项目可使用MySQL Community Server,大型项目可选择MySQL Enterprise Server。
(2)性能需求:根据业务需求,选择具有高性能的MySQL服务器类型。
(3)预算:企业版MySQL Enterprise Server功能更丰富,但价格较高。
3. 问题:如何优化MySQL服务器性能?
回答:
(1)合理配置MySQL配置文件(my.cnf)。
(2)定期进行数据备份和恢复。
(3)使用性能监控工具,实时了解数据库性能。
(4)优化SQL语句,提高查询效率。
4. 问题:MySQL Cluster和MySQL ClusterCGE有什么区别?
回答:MySQL Cluster和MySQL ClusterCGE都是基于分布式存储和计算技术的MySQL集群服务器。区别在于:
(1)MySQL Cluster:适用于高性能、高可用性的场景,如金融、电信等。
(2)MySQL ClusterCGE:是MySQL Cluster在云环境下的实现,适用于云计算、大数据等场景。
四、总结
MySQL服务器类型的配置对于确保数据库稳定运行、高效服务至关重要。本文从MySQL服务器类型的概述、配置要点、衍升问题及相关问答等方面进行了深入探讨。在实际应用中,应根据项目需求、性能需求、预算等因素选择合适的MySQL服务器类型,并对其进行合理配置,以确保数据库的稳定、高效运行。
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。
工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态